1How does Vernon's high-desert climate affect my choice of flooring material?

Vernon's climate features hot, dry summers and cool winters with significant temperature swings, which can cause some flooring materials to expand, contract, or crack. We highly recommend materials with good dimensional stability for our area, such as luxury vinyl plank (LVP), tile, or properly acclimated engineered hardwood. Solid hardwood can be more prone to gaps and warping here due to the low humidity, so it requires a carefully controlled indoor environment.

2What is the typical cost range for professional flooring installation in the Vernon area?

Installation costs in Vernon and surrounding Apache County vary based on material and subfloor preparation. Basic carpet installation may start around $2-$5 per square foot, while tile or hardwood typically ranges from $4-$12+ per square foot. Local factors like travel distance for contractors from larger towns (e.g., Show Low, Springerville) can sometimes add a small trip fee, so it's best to get itemized quotes from providers serving our specific rural area.

3Are there any local permits or regulations in Vernon I need to be aware of before installing new flooring?

For standard residential flooring replacement in an existing home, a permit is usually not required in unincorporated Apache County. However, if your installation is part of a larger remodel that involves altering the home's structure, electrical, or plumbing, you should check with the Apache County Planning and Zoning Department. Always confirm with your chosen licensed contractor, as they should handle any necessary permitting.

4What's the best time of year to schedule flooring installation in Vernon, and how long does it usually take?

Late spring through early fall is ideal, as winter weather can delay material deliveries and make it difficult for crews to travel safely. A typical single-room installation (like a living room) often takes 1-2 days, while a whole-house project may take 3-7 days, depending on complexity. Always allow extra time for material delivery to our rural location and for proper acclimation of wood or laminate products to your home's interior conditions.

5How do I choose a reliable flooring installer serving the Vernon community?

Seek local referrals from neighbors or hardware stores in Springerville/Eagar. Verify the contractor is licensed, bonded, and insured to work in Arizona. A reputable installer serving our area will be knowledgeable about our climate's impact on flooring, provide a detailed written estimate, and clearly explain the preparation and installation process. Always ask for local references and examples of past work completed in the White Mountains region.
